titleOfInvention Aromatic polyimide film and its production
abstract PURPOSE: To obtain the title film in which a metal oxide is uniformly dispersed in a state of fine particles and which is excellent in mechanical strengths and dimensional stability, by casting or applying a composition formed by adding a metal oxide sol to a varnish of, e.g., an aromatic polyimide on or to a base and heating it. n CONSTITUTION: A composition is obtained by adding 1W100pts.wt. (in terms of the metal oxide) metal oxide sol such as silica sol, alumina sol, iron oxide sol or titania sol and, optionally, 5wt.% or below silane coupling agent (e.g., methyltrimethoxysilane) to 100pts.wt. (in terms of component (a)) aromatic polyimide (a) having repeating units of formula I (wherein Ar 1 is a group of any one of formulas IIWIV, Ar 2 is a group of any one of formulas VWVII, R is a 1W3C alkyl, alkoxy or a halogen, X is O, S, SO 2 , a 1W13C alkylene or a group of formula VIII and m and n are each 0W2) or a varnish (b) of a polyamic acid as a precursor of component (a). This composition is cast on or applied to a base such as glass and either dried at 60W170°C for 30W120min or heated at 200W400°C. n COPYRIGHT: (C)1988,JPO&Japio
